BK16 VWW is a 2016 Suzuki Vitara in White with a 1,373c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2016 Suzuki Vitara models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.7% with a typical mileage of 43,162 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ki Vitara f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 34,457 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K16 VWW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Vitara typ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 10 years old, this Suzuki Vitara is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
